windows/ ubuntu side by side boot problem after ubuntu update.
 
i recently installed ubuntu 10.4 side by side on my machine. a short time ago i ran update manager and installed updates. the system prompted me to restart, which i did. the machine went to the boot screen and i selected ubuntu. upon doing this it goes right back to the boot screen, giving me the same choice. i should add that i am able to select windows, but that is something i rarely want to do. any suggestions? thanks.

colorpurple21859 01-15-2011 11:00 PM

The most likely cause is The update hosed you grub install. You will have to use the cd to rescue grub. There is a good howto some where in the ubuntu forums. There are also several threads here about the problem and how to fix.
